Disney+'s Monsters Inc. series Monsters at Work has debuted its full cast of colorful and creepy creatures.

In addition to franchise mainstays Mike Wazowski and James P. Sullivan (Sulley), the show will welcome Tylor Tuskmon, Fritz, Val Little, Cutter and Duncan.

Monsters At Work takes place the day after the Monsters, Incorporated power plant started harvesting the laughter of children to fuel the city of Monstropolis, thanks to Mike and Sulley's discovery that laughter generates ten times more energy than screams. It follows the story of Tylor Tuskmon, an eager young monster who graduated top of his class at Monsters University and always dreamed of becoming a Scarer until he lands a job at Monsters, Incorporated, and discovers that scaring is out and laughter is in. After Tylor is temporarily reassigned to the Monsters, Inc. Facilities Team (MIFT), he must work alongside a misfit bunch of mechanics while setting his sights on becoming a Jokester.

Monsters at Work stars Billy Crystal, John Goodman, Bonnie Hunt, Ben Feldman, Mindy Kaling, Henry Winkler, Lucas Neff, Alanna Ubach, John Ratzenberger, Jennifer Tilly, Bob Peterson, Stephen Stanton and Aisha Tyler. The series has yet to receive a premiere date.
